It's a Small World: International Expansion for Startups

Date: Tuesday, May 14, 2024

Time: 12:00 - 1:00 PM ET

Join us for It's a Small World: International Expansion for Startups on May 14 at 12 PM ET.

Hosted by GoGlobal, this webinar brings together industry experts and successful founders to delve into the intricacies of expanding into international markets.

We will be featuring insights from the Founder and CEO of Alariss Global, a leading company specializing in assisting foreign businesses to establish and flourish in the U.S., and the Founder of Spontivly, a cutting-edge SaaS platform revolutionizing how founders create reports with intuitive drag-and-drop tools. Together, our panelists will share their wealth of experience and expertise, offering practical strategies and valuable advice for scaling startups in today's market as well as navigating the complexities of today's increasingly international startup world.

From identifying growth opportunities to overcoming regulatory challenges and cultural barriers, this webinar will provide invaluable insights and actionable tips for early-stage companies looking to scale globally. Don't miss this opportunity to learn from seasoned entrepreneurs and industry leaders as they discuss the keys to success in the global marketplace.

Meet Our Panelists

Anthony-Nagendraraj-headshot

Anthony Nagendraraj

Co-Founder & CEO of Spontivly

Anthony brings 15+ years of experience in enterprise sales and product management for Fortune 500 companies like IBM and Microsoft, leveraging technology in innovative ways to help fuel growth and sales.

Anthony has also successfully exited two companies, both focused on helping businesses understand how best to use innovative technology to meet growth and sales targets.

Joyce-Zhang-headshot

Joyce Zhang

CEO & Founder at Alariss Global

Joyce was previously the first employee and Head of Sales for Human Interest, a Silicon Valley-based financial services technology company. Prior to that, she worked for the President of Microsoft Asia-Pacific in Singapore, as a regional manager for Groupon China (JV with Tencent) and for McKinsey & Co.

In the public sector, Joyce worked for the Federal Reserve Bank of New York, the World Bank’s International Finance Corporation in Nairobi, Kenya, and the U.S. Department of Labor’s International Economics team in Washington DC.
